Market Sizing, Growth Estimates, and CAGR Projections

Based on recent industry data, the South Korea pre-crash seatbelt market was valued at approximately $150 million

in 2023. This valuation considers the integration of advanced safety systems in new vehicles, regulatory mandates, and increasing consumer safety awareness. The market is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.2%

over the next five years, reaching an estimated $220 million

by 2028.

Assumptions underpinning these projections include:

  • Steady vehicle production growth at around 3-4% annually, driven by domestic demand and export expansion.
  • Enhanced regulatory standards mandating pre-crash safety features in new vehicles, with a compliance rate expected to reach 85% by 2028.
  • Increasing consumer preference for integrated safety systems, especially in premium and mid-range vehicle segments.
  • Technological advancements reducing costs of sensors and electronic control units (ECUs), fostering wider adoption.

Technological Advancements & Emerging Opportunities

Technological evolution is pivotal in shaping the pre-crash seatbelt market:

  • Sensor Fusion & AI:

    Integration of radar, lidar, and camera sensors with AI algorithms enables real-time hazard detection, triggering pre-crash seatbelt engagement.

  • Electromechanical Systems:

    Development of smart seatbelt retractors and pretensioners that activate instantaneously upon detection of imminent collision.

  • Connectivity & IoT:

    Linking safety systems with vehicle telematics and cloud platforms facilitates predictive maintenance, system diagnostics, and data analytics for continuous improvement.

  • Emerging Niches:

    Focus on retrofit solutions for existing vehicles, and integration with autonomous vehicle platforms, presenting lucrative growth avenues.

Digital Transformation & Industry Standards

Digitalization is transforming the pre-crash seatbelt landscape:

  • System Integration:

    Seamless interoperability with vehicle ECUs, ADAS, and autonomous driving platforms enhances safety performance.

  • Standards & Protocols:

    Adoption of ISO 26262 functional safety standards, AUTOSAR communication protocols, and emerging cybersecurity frameworks ensures system robustness and compliance.

  • Cross-Industry Collaborations:

    Partnerships between automotive OEMs, tech firms, and sensor manufacturers accelerate innovation and standardization efforts.

Cost Structures, Pricing Strategies, & Risks

Understanding cost dynamics is vital for strategic positioning:

  • Cost Structures:

    Raw materials (~40%), electronic components (~25%), assembly labor (~15%), R&D (~10%), and overhead (~10%).

  • Pricing Strategies:

    Premium pricing for advanced, integrated systems; volume discounts for OEM bulk orders; aftermarket retrofit kits priced competitively to stimulate secondary markets.

  • Capital Investment Patterns:

    Significant R&D investment in sensor miniaturization, AI algorithms, and cybersecurity; manufacturing automation to reduce unit costs.

  • Key Risks:

    Regulatory delays, cybersecurity vulnerabilities, supply chain disruptions, and technological obsolescence pose challenges to sustained growth.
